🎯 Goal Setting and Time Management

Effective study begins with clear goals and smart time management. Here’s how:

  • Set SMART Goals: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ound.
  • Create a Study Schedule: Allocate specific times for each subject. Consistency is key!
  • Prioritize Tasks: Use methods like the Eisenhower Matrix (Urgent/Important) to focus on what matters most.

✍️ Active Learning Techniques

Passive reading isn't enough. Engage actively with the material:

  1. Summarization: After reading a section, summarize the key points in your own words.
  2. Questioning: Ask yourself questions about the material. If you can't answer, revisit the section.
  3. Teaching: Explain the concepts to someone else. Teaching reinforces your understanding.

🧠 Memory and Retention Strategies

Enhance your memory with these proven techniques:

  • Spaced Repetition: Review material at increasing intervals. Tools like Anki can help.
  • Mnemonics: Use acronyms, rhymes, or images to remember complex information.
  • Elaboration: Connect new information to what you already know. This creates stronger neural pathways.

πŸ“ Note-Taking Methods

Effective note-taking is crucial for review and retention. Consider these methods:

  • Cornell Method: Divide your paper into sections for notes, cues, and summary.
  • Mind Mapping: Visually organize information around a central concept.
  • Linear Note-Taking: Traditional method of writing notes in a sequential manner.

πŸ“š Effective Reading Strategies

Improve your reading comprehension with these techniques:

  • SQ3R Method: Survey, Question, Read, Recite, Review.
  • Active Recall: Pause periodically to recall what you've read.
  • Speed Reading: Practice techniques to increase your reading speed without sacrificing comprehension.

πŸ§˜β€β™€οΈ Maintaining Well-being

Don't neglect your physical and mental health:

  • Regular Breaks: Take short breaks to avoid burnout.
  • Sufficient Sleep: Aim for 7-8 hours of sleep per night.
  • Healthy Diet: Eat nutritious foods to fuel your brain.
  • Exercise: Physical activity improves cognitive function.

✍️ Exam Preparation Tips

Prepare effectively for exams:

  • Review Past Papers: Familiarize yourself with the exam format and types of questions.
  • Practice Tests: Simulate exam conditions to build confidence.
  • Create a Study Guide: Summarize key concepts and formulas.
